SXSW Sydney 2024 announces shortlists for gaming and film awards

adminBy adminOctober 2, 2024No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Reddit WhatsApp Email
Share
Facebook Twitter Pinterest Reddit WhatsApp Email


With less than two weeks until SXSW Sydney 2024 takes place in Darling Harbour, the gaming festival has announced the shortlist for its highly anticipated 2024 Games & Screen Awards. One of the festival’s signature events, the awards recognize outstanding indie games from the festival’s showcase, celebrating the best in mechanical design, gameplay, narrative, and creative direction.

Here’s a breakdown of all shortlisted categories:

best international game

The awards recognize outstanding games developed outside of Australia and New Zealand and celebrate the innovative efforts of global developers.

Candidate:

discovery award

Spotlighting emerging developers and new studios, the Discovery Awards recognize the freshest titles introduced at the SXSW Sydney Games Showcase.

Candidate:

game of the year

SXSW Sydney Game of the Year is all about celebrating the pinnacle of artistry and design. This award shines a light on titles that demonstrate incredible technical skill and limitless creativity, delivering a truly outstanding gaming experience.

Candidate:

award night

The winner will be announced at Fortress Sydney on Saturday 19th October at 7pm. In addition to the main category, three further awards will be given out on the night.

• People’s Choice Award – Public voting begins on October 14, 2024 and ends on October 19, 2024. Fans can vote for their favorite games from the showcase.

• Tabletop Award – This award recognizes primarily non-digital games, such as card games, board games, and role-playing games, that are thoughtfully designed and provide an engaging solo or social experience.

• Best Student Game – This award spotlights outstanding student games in the Student Showcase, celebrating the bold creativity, radical innovation, and unstoppable passion of up-and-coming developers.
